Why Choose a Tablet Under $100?
While flagship tablets offer premium experiences, a sub-$100 tablet is perfect for several use cases. They are excellent for:
- Casual browsing and social media: Staying connected without tying up your smartphone.
- E-reading: Enjoying books and magazines on a dedicated screen.
- Streaming video: Watching movies and TV shows on the go.
- Simple gaming: Playing casual games and puzzles.
- Kids’ entertainment: Providing a safe and engaging device for children.
Just remember that these budget tablets will likely have limitations in terms of processing power and storage compared to more expensive models. However, for basic tasks, they get the job done.

Amazon Fire HD 7 (2022 Release)
The Amazon Fire HD 7 is a consistently popular choice in this price range. It offers a decent 7-inch display, access to Amazon’s vast app store, and a surprisingly long battery life. It’s particularly well-suited for Amazon Prime members due to seamless integration with Prime Video and other services. The latest version boasts improved processing power over previous iterations.
- Display: 7-inch IPS LCD
- Processor: Quad-core processor
- Storage: Typically 16GB or 32GB (expandable via microSD)
- Operating System: Fire OS (based on Android)
Lenovo Tab M7
Lenovo’s Tab M7 is another strong contender, offering a clean Android experience without the Amazon bloatware. It’s known for its portability and ease of use. While the specs are similar to the Fire HD 7, some users prefer the more familiar Android interface.
- Display: 7-inch IPS LCD
- Processor: MediaTek Quad-Core Processor
- Storage: 32GB (expandable via microSD)
- Operating System: Android
Insignia™ – 7″ 16GB Tablet
Best Buy’s in-house brand, Insignia, offers a very affordable 7-inch tablet. It’s a no-frills option, but provides basic functionality for those on a tight budget. Don’t expect high-end performance, but it’s suitable for simple tasks like reading and web browsing.
- Display: 7-inch LCD
- Processor: Quad-Core Processor
- Storage: 16GB (expandable via microSD)
- Operating System: Android 11
What to Consider When Buying a Budget Tablet
Before making a purchase, consider these factors:
- Operating System: Do you prefer the Amazon Fire OS ecosystem or the more open Android experience?
- Storage: How much storage do you need? Most budget tablets offer expandable storage via microSD cards, which is a good option if you plan to download a lot of apps or media.
- Display Quality: A brighter, sharper display will make for a more enjoyable viewing experience.
- Battery Life: Look for a tablet that can last at least six to eight hours on a single charge.
- Processor: A faster processor will improve performance, especially when multitasking.
